Sunny Weber has written yet another dog training tool in her release of City Dog Walking Safety and Etiquette. It provides some excellent pointers for those who walk their dogs through neighborhoods and urban areas. It gives several scenarios on what to do and what not to do. These include: dogs pulling, dealing other dogs that are not securely leashed, being greeted by bicyclists, coming across wildlife, and circumstances when your favorite canine goes crazy over every little thing. Sunny Weber gives some tips that would help to cope with these and other scenarios. It is important to teaching your loving furry friend good manners and practicing safety precautions will make a fun, stressful and uneventful bonding moment with them. All throughout the book are illustrations that will help the reader to better understand what the author is trying to convey. I thought this was a great book to have on hand, as well as, would be a great gift for new dog owners or for ones who are struggling with their furry pal.

I am giving City Dog Walking Safety and Etiquette four and a half stars. Dog lovers and owners that have a beloved canine within the city limits and needs a daily walking will definitely want to read this one. I am curious to see what other dog loving books Sunny Weber releases next.

REVIEW by LAWonder10:
From Wild to Mild is sure to become a highly sought after series!
This is a story from an Australian Shepherd's view.
Kaya was confused and scared. It was getting dark, she was in an enclosed yard, and some strange people had taken her away from the warmth and home of her mother. She see two eyes in the shrub. Can it be her mother? She slowly moves closer to see and an animal quickly grabs her by her neck and runs a long way. Kaya soon discovers, he want to eat her!
Kaya discovers this is a coyote, but the mother, with her own two pups, refused to eat her. So Kaya crawled in the middle of the two pups to get warm. Thus, she must learn to survive in a new world, or die.
This is an outstanding series, of acceptance, rejection, love, hate, adjustments, discovering own's self worth and place in life. I am excited to read the next in the series!
Easy analogies can be made between the human and animal species. This book will surely inspire discussion
Elementary aged children, young adults and adults alike, will find this series very entertaining. This is an ideal series for "Family-Time" reading, Summer Reading Programs, or just for personal enjoyment.
The Cover of the Book is beautifully created and the Title is very "Fitting". This is sure to "catch the eye" of the "Browser".
